SUDBURY, Ont. – After 632 minutes UOIT freshman
Helen Frampton's shutout streak came to an end after Laurentian scored just eight minutes into their game on Sunday. The goal also broke up another one of UOIT's runs as it proved to be the game winner, ending the Ridgebacks' six-game unbeaten streak.
Brianne Rodrigue scored Laurentian's goal off a header giving the Voyageurs the season sweep over the Ridgebacks.
UOIT had a number of chances to score with 11 shots recorded, but only four of them managed to end up on target. Goalkeeper Richele Greenwood stopped everything she faced for her second shutout victory over UOIT. This was her third cleansheet of the season.
Sara Voisin (Waterloo, Ont.) had a team-high four shots for UOIT.
With the win, Laurentian (7-3-2) moves one point ahead of the Ridgebacks (7-3-1) for second place in the OUA eastern conference standings, with UOIT having one game in hand. Carleton, Queen's, Toronto and Nipissing are close behind as just four points separate all of the teams.
UOIT will be back in action at home on Friday night when they host the Queen's Gaels. Game time is 6 p.m.
